Medical/Clinical Assistant Schools in New York

2,776 Medical/Clinical Assistant students earned their degrees in the state in 2020-2021.

As a degree choice, Medical/Clinical Assistant is the 1st most popular major in the state.

Racial Distribution

The racial distribution of medical/clinical assistant majors in New York is as follows:

  • Asian: 5.9%
  • Black or African American: 37.0%
  • Hispanic or Latino: 33.1%
  • White: 12.7%
  • Non-Resident Alien: 2.0%
  • Other Races: 9.3%

Jobs for Medical/Clinical Assistant Grads in New York

26,080 people in the state and 673,660 in the nation are employed in jobs related to medical/clinical assistant.

undefined

Wages for Medical/Clinical Assistant Jobs in New York

A typical salary for a medical/clinical assistant grad in the state is $37,560, compared to a typical salary of $34,540 nationwide.
